The Getting older Brain: What's Regular and What's Not

Some cognitive improvements are in truth part of normal getting older. As we get older, our brains system information and facts extra slowly, and we might need much more time to learn new things or remember data. You could from time to time neglect in which you parked your car or perhaps the name of an acquaintance you have not observed in many years. Normal growing old may well mean using longer to recall facts, occasional trouble getting phrases, in some cases misplacing products, or minimal trouble with multitasking.

Even so, ordinary getting older shouldn't noticeably interfere together with your everyday operating. You'll want to continue to be capable of regulate your finances, comply with your medication agenda, maintain your family, and engage in your preferred routines.

Mild Cognitive Impairment: The In-Amongst State

Martha recognized she was getting trouble following her e-book club conversations. Her doctor diagnosed her with Moderate Cognitive Impairment—a situation that exists from the Area amongst typical getting old and dementia.

MCI results in cognitive variations that are obvious for you and sometimes to Those people near to you, but they do not considerably disrupt your every day routines. Think about MCI as a yellow warning light-weight—not yet crimson, but certainly not eco-friendly.

With MCI, you might ignore essential conversations or appointments, lose your practice of imagined all through discussions, have improved problems earning decisions, really feel overcome by complex tasks, or battle to search out your way in unfamiliar environments.

Inspite of these difficulties, you'll be able to commonly nevertheless manage every day responsibilities independently. You remember to choose prescription drugs, can prepare foods, and handle family funds, whether or not these tasks consider more focus than right before.

Alzheimer's Disorder: When Cognitive Variations Disrupt Independence

Compared with MCI, Alzheimer's sickness progressively impacts your ability to operate independently. It really is the commonest form of dementia, accounting for the majority of conditions.

Frank's household grew to become concerned when he bought missing driving into the grocery store he'd visited weekly for twenty decades. He also began possessing issues managing his checking account and would check with the same queries repeatedly, not remembering he had currently acquired solutions.

In early Alzheimer's, you may perhaps knowledge sizeable memory decline that disrupts way of life, worries in scheduling or resolving challenges, and problem completing familiar responsibilities. People today normally working experience confusion about time or put, issues knowledge visual images, and new issues with terms in speaking or producing. Misplacing factors without having with the ability more info to retrace techniques, reduced judgment, withdrawal from activities, and improvements in mood and temperament can also be popular indicators.

As Alzheimer's progresses, indications turn into more extreme. Inevitably, folks involve assistance with standard things to do like dressing, consuming, and personal care.

Crucial Discrepancies and Mind Variations

The primary distinction in between MCI and Alzheimer's lies in practical independence. With MCI, every day working stays largely intact In spite of apparent cognitive alterations. With Alzheimer's, cognitive decrease interferes substantially with the chance to handle independently.

An additional essential distinction is development. When all men and women with Alzheimer's knowledge worsening signs with time, MCI follows a much less predictable route. Some people with MCI keep on being stable for years, some strengthen and return to typical cognition, and others progress to Alzheimer's or another kind of dementia. Research indicates close to 10-15% of individuals with MCI build dementia yearly.

Each ailments include Bodily variations inside the brain, but to unique levels. In MCI, Mind scans may perhaps display gentle shrinkage while in the hippocampus and compact accumulations of irregular proteins. In Alzheimer's, these changes tend to be more in depth, with widespread plaques and tangles disrupting communication in between brain cells and ultimately leading to cell Dying.

Running Memory Concerns

Whilst there are no FDA-authorized medications especially for MCI, investigation indicates a number of strategies which will support. Joseph was diagnosed with MCI soon after noticing memory troubles. His health care provider encouraged a comprehensive solution: Joseph joined a strolling club, adopted a Mediterranean-style eating plan, started out playing bridge on a regular basis, and addressed his significant blood pressure. Soon after 6 months, he observed his wondering appeared clearer.

Existing administration procedures for MCI contain frequent Actual physical workout, Mediterranean or Head diet, cognitive stimulation, social engagement, correct management of health care disorders, high quality sleep, and worry administration.

For Alzheimer's disease, therapy normally contains drugs which could briefly boost indicators or slow development, administration of behavioral indicators, supportive care as the disease innovations, and Life style interventions just like Individuals suggested for MCI.

Several prescription drugs are at the moment accepted for Alzheimer's, such as cholinesterase inhibitors and memantine. Whilst these You should not end the fundamental brain variations, they could help retain perform for a longer period.

The Power of Neuropsychological Assessment

When you are concerned about alterations in your memory or contemplating qualities, a neuropsychological assessment gives the most thorough evaluation.

Compared with brief screenings at a physician's Office environment, a neuropsychological evaluation comprehensively examines different cognitive domains via specialized tests. This comprehensive strategy can differentiate among standard growing older, MCI, and Alzheimer's, even from the early phases when distinctions are subtle.

Through the evaluation, a neuropsychologist will Examine your memory, awareness, language talents, visual-spatial abilities, planning, Corporation, challenge-fixing, processing velocity, and reasoning talents. The outcome provide a baseline for monitoring modifications over time and tutorial recommendations for procedure and assist.
